• Ahmad Bradshaw is a National Football League running back who plays for the New York Giants. Bradshaw finished the 2007 season with a total of 190 yards rushing on 23 carries.

    On February 17, 2009, Bradshaw turned himself in to the Tazewell County Jail to begin serving the remainder of his 60-day sentence. He previously served the first 30 days of the sentence, for a probation violation, in June of 2008.The New York Times: Giants' Bradshaw Serving Rest of Jail Sentence

  • Football Career

    Prior to playing in the NFL, Bradshaw played college football with the Marshall Thundering Herd. Playing 32 games over three seasons, he recorded 552 carries for 2,987 yards and 31 touchdowns. Adding in his 86 receptions for 696 yards, Bradshaw finished his collegiate career as the 10th player in school history to total 4,000 all-purpose yards. After college, Bradshaw was selected 250th overall in the 2007 NFL draft by the New York Giants.Official Site of the New York Giants: Ahmad Bradshaw

    Bradshaw made his professional debut with the New York Giants in 2007, playing in 12 games and recording 23 rushes for 190 yards and one touchdown. He also helped the Giants upset the New England Patriots to win Super Bowl XLII. In 2008, Bradshaw's stats improved as he totaled 67 rushes for 355 yards and one touchdown, as well as five receptions for 42 yards and a single score.NFL.com: Ahmad Bradshaw

  • Probation Violation

    In June of 2008, Bradshaw checked himself into the Southwest Virginia Regional Jail and served a 30-day sentence for a probation violation.Yahoo Sports: Giants RB Bradshaw in jail (June 19, 2007) The probation stems from a 2006 petty larceny charge while he was in college.
